Once you activate the mobile theme plugin, the front page will be predefined. There will be a top grid displaying your featured posts and then a latest post section. More about the mobile theme here
https://forum.tagdiv.com/the-mobile-theme/
The grid will only be displayed in the homepage, so will the latest articles section. Other mobile pages will have to be created with the mobile editor only.
This is meant to improve the performance of the website by keeping it as light as possible.
If you would be able to display grids and blocks on mobile pages, then there would be no purpose for the mobile plugin, it would be the same as without it.
